Cash Management: - Cash management comprises maintaining optimum cash balance and efficient collection and disbursement of cash.

Methods or else Devices of Cash Management: - The subsequent are the methods of cash management:

(1) Cash Budget

 (2) Cash Flow Statements

(3) Cash Flow Ratios

(4) Cash Management Model or Baumol Model.
